Communities play a huge part in Discord's mission. Millions of people come to Discord every day to hang out in communities for all kinds of interests, from servers where thousands of Harry Potter fans connect and geek out, to servers where students practice speaking new languages with native speakers halfway across the world.

At the heart of communities are the admins and moderators who build and run them. The Online Communities Group at Discord is responsible for empowering these creators to build thriving spaces that many people call their second home. We believe helping creators succeed is pivotal to creating more healthy communities.

Discord is looking for a highly technical, creative, hands-on, and mission-focused Engineering Manager on our Communities Engagement team to partner with other teams across the organization. You will be responsible for the engineers building out new exciting features used by millions of communities across Discord. This role will own the creation and organization of this team to support our growth plans, including recruiting for the ICs of those teams and ensuring their success.
